#9725e9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9725e9 is composed of 59.2% red, 14.5%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.2%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 274.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 52.9%. #9725e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aff with #2f00d3.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

Shades and Tints of #9725e9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08010e is the darkest color, while #fdf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9725e9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88818d is the less saturated color, while #9a13fb is the most saturated one.
